WebJun 6, 2024 · Lignin has a phenolic structure with high hydrophobicity that makes it as a promising bioreplacement of phenol in the synthesis of PF resins. However, lignin has low reactivity toward formaldehyde compared with phenol due to its high molecular weight and steric hindering. WebLignin, as the most abundant natural polyphenol, has similar chemical structures to that of phenol. Lignin has received increasing attention as a potential feedstock for renewable fuels and chemical production.
